Researchers at Harvard have found chemicals linked with cases of severe respiratory disease in over 75 percent of flavored e-cigarettes. Diacetyl, acetoin, and 2,3-pentanedione, flavoring compounds that the Flavor and Extract Manufacturers Association lists as “high priority,” have been found in 47 of 51 flavors tested.
